    Sainmhíniú "system established in 2004 by the General Product Safety Directive that allows the 31 participating countries (EU countries, Norway, Iceland and Liechtenstein) and the European Commission to exchange information on products (with the exception of food, pharmaceuticals and medical devices) posing a risk to the health and safety of consumers and on the measures taken by these countries to overcome that risk" Tagairt "COM-EN, based on:European Commission > Consumers > Safety > Alerts (RAPEX), http://ec.europa.eu/consumers/safety/rapex/index_en.htm [17.12.2014]"
    Nóta National authorities take measures to prevent or restrict the marketing or use of those dangerous products. Both measures ordered by national authorities and measures taken 'voluntarily' by producers and distributors are reported via the system.RAPEX also covers products posing risks to the health and safety of professional users and to other public interests protected by relevant EU legislation (e.g. environment and security). It does not cover food, pharmaceuticals and medical devices, which are covered by other mechanisms.

    Nóta "GRAS (General Rapid Alert System) is a common online platform for four rapid alert systems managed by DG SANCO:- Rapid Alert System for non-food consumer products (RAPEX) [ IATE:1062944 ]- Rapid Alert System for Food and Feed (RASFF)- Rapid Alert System for Chemical agents (RAS-CHEM)- Rapid Alert System for-Biological and Chemical Attacks and Threats (RAS-BICHAT)."

    Sainmhíniú rapid alert system for quick exchange of information between EU/EEA member states and the European Commission about dangerous non-food products posing a risk to health and safety of consumers Tagairt "European Commission > Safety Gate: the rapid alert system for dangerous non-food products (8.12.2023)"
    Nóta The Safety Gate Rapid Alert System is the internal system through which authorities and the Commission exchange information on measures concerning dangerous products, and which can contain confidential information. An extract of alerts should be published on the Safety Gate Portal in order to inform the public about dangerous products. The Safety Business Gateway is the web portal through which businesses inform market surveillance authorities of the Member States about dangerous products and about accidents.
